July 21, 20223 yr I think we're going to move to FAAB (free agent budget) instead of waivers. Each team will have a $200 cap on the amount they can spend during the season on free agent adds. I think it's way better than plain waivers or just first come, first serve. It gives each team equal shot at every player and allows for more strategy. We'll have that limited for only the first day after the Monday night game and then allow for free adds later in the week to make for easy roster management while dealing with injuries and all that. To me, that's more of a reason to have less teams make the playoffs. It's one thing to string together 3 wins in the playoffs to win a title, but it's a whole other thing to have a strong record during the whole season to deserve making the playoffs. There's a lot of luck in fantasy football, and I think having less teams make the playoffs would take some of that out of it. But I'm open to it.
